MobiQuitous 2023 invites proposals for workshops of the 20th EAI International Conference on Mobile and Ubiquitous Systems: Computing, Networking and Services, to be held as an on-site conference (with an option to present remotely) in Melbourne, Australia, November 14-17, 2023.
We are soliciting workshop proposals on any topic relevant to Mobile and Ubiquitous Computing. All workshops will be held on 14th November 2023. Workshops are a great opportunity for community building and a forum for attendees with common interests. Accepted workshop papers are included in the adjunct proceedings of the MobiQuitous Conference and will be accessible via the Springer digital library.

Workshop Proposal Content
The proposal should be prepared as a document of no more than 4 pages in the official Springer proceedings format using a tighter alternate style (Word, Latex). Also, please include a Call for Papers. The document should describe the topic, rationale, and objectives for the workshop, the organizers’ backgrounds and bio, and an estimate of expected attendance. In the case of follow-up workshops, please provide statistics from any previously held workshops and a detailed plan (timeline) for conducting the workshop (including any plans for pre-workshop preparation and/or post-workshop follow-up).
Workshop Selection Process
Workshops will be reviewed based on several factors, including:
- The potential for the topic of the workshop to generate stimulating discussions and useful results.
- The expected interest of the community in the workshop topic.
- The quality, organization, and plan described in the workshop proposal.
- Relevance to the main conference.
In the case of multiple submissions on similar topics, organizers may be encouraged to merge them.
Workshop Organizers’ Responsibilities
The organizers of each workshop will:
- Publicize the workshop with a call for participation via the MobiQuitous website
- Set up your own website for the workshop containing more details on the workshop, including CFP, workshop format, plans for publication (if any), participants, program, etc.
- Provide the address of the workshop website to conference organizers (mobiquitous.eai-conferences.org will then point to the individual workshop websites)
- Encourage potential participants to submit papers
- Work with the MobiQuitous Publication Chairs to include workshop papers in the Springer digital library and the supplementary proceedings
- Work with the MobiQuitous Workshop Chairs to arrange the workshop
- Actively run the workshop
